Beacon Hill Resources Plc ('Beacon Hill' or 'the Group')
Arthur River Mining Lease Objection Withdrawn
Beacon Hill Resources plc (AIM:BHR), the AIM listed resource company, is pleased to provide an update with regard to the development of its Arthur River magnesite project in north-west Tasmania, which has a current JORC-compliant measured and inferred resource of 39 million tonnes of magnesite.
Further to the announcement by the Group on 18 March 2010, Beacon Hill is pleased to announce that it has received notification that the objection to its Mining Lease Application has been withdrawn.
Justin Lewis, Executive Chairman said, "The Board is delighted that the process before the Mining Tribunal is now at an end and the Group's application can now progress through the remainder of the application process. We do not expect any other hurdles and look forward to being granted a Mining Lease."
